DUG Technology Past Earnings Performance
Past criteria checks 3/6
DUG Technology has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 44%, while the Software industry saw earnings growing at 24.6%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 14% per year. DUG Technology's return on equity is 16.1%, and it has net margins of 6.9%.

Past Earnings Growth Analysis
Earnings Trend: DUG has become profitable over the past 5 years, growing earnings by 44% per year.
Accelerating Growth: DUG has become profitable in the last year, making the earnings growth rate difficult to compare to its 5-year average.
Earnings vs Industry: DUG has become profitable in the last year, making it difficult to compare its past year earnings growth to the Software industry (12%).
